<p>People of faith along the Red River Valley are invited to come together for a <em>Worship Service for the Family of God</em>. The service will be an opportunity for persons who care about the five American Crystal Sugar plants along the Valley—farmers/growers, union workers, management, and <em>their neighbors</em>—to gather together simply for prayers, songs, and readings from Scripture.<strong> Two ecumenical worship services</strong> will be offered in Grand Forks, ND.<span id="more-3197"></span></p>
<p>The first service will be held <strong>Sunday, December 18, at 2:00 p.m. at Holy Family Parish, 1018 18</strong><strong>th </strong><strong>Ave So, Grand Forks, ND </strong>(701.746.1454). Fr. Phil Ackerman, Holy Family Parish, will lead the worship service.</p>
<p>A second service will be held <strong>Wednesday, December 21, at 5:30 p.m. at United Lutheran Church, 324 Chestnut St, Grand Forks, ND </strong>(701-775-4279). Pastors from area Christian churches will lead the worship service. The service will be followed by <strong>a 6:30 p.m. catered dinner in the church’s Fellowship Hall</strong>, courtesy of a donor.</p>
<p>Red River Valley faith leaders who are planning this service and dinner believe this could be an important contribution from the faith community to help bring out the best in all members of the Crystal Sugar family as they work together toward finding a good settlement. If you are unable to attend, please remember all our friends affiliated with Crystal Sugar in your prayers.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<h3>A Missional Spiritual Discovery Journey for Congregations</h3>
<p><em>Re-rooting in God’s Mission</em> is a renewal journey and process for congregations seeking to move from maintenance to mission and from survival to striving.</p>
<h4>Saturday, February 25, 2012</h4>
<p>9:30 am &#8211; 3:30 pm<br />
<em>Olivet Lutheran Church &#8211; Fargo, ND</em><span id="more-3191"></span></p>
<h4><strong><img class="alignright  wp-image-3192" title="ReRooting" src="http://www.eandsynod.org/news/wp-content/uploads/2011/12/ReRooting.jpg" alt="" width="180" height="180" />About the Journey: </strong></h4>
<p><strong></strong><em>Re-rooting in God’s Mission</em> is a process designed to <strong>unfold over an 18 to 24 month period of time</strong>. The process involves four or more Saturday equipping events (9:30 a.m. to 3:30 p.m.) sprinkled throughout these months. These <strong>equipping events</strong> will revolve around listening to God through prayer, scripture, each other, our neighbors, and three key ingredients for congregational renewal:</p>
<ol>
<li><strong>Discovering a shared purpose</strong> for participating in God’s mission locally and beyond</li>
<li><strong>Willingness to change</strong> for the sake of the Gospel</li>
<li><strong>Shared leadership</strong> between pastor and congregational leaders</li>
</ol>
<p><em>(an ELCA research study identified these 3 key ingredients for renewal)</em></p>
<p>This process of renewal seeks to engage and involve the whole congregation. It begins and continues with prayer and in-depth engagement with God’s word. <strong>A team of at least four, including pastor, </strong>selected by the congregation and pastor, attend the training opportunities in order to be equipped to engage their congregation in a renewal process focusing on:</p>
<ul>
<li>Attending to God in prayer and scripture</li>
<li>Accompanying one another in following Jesus and being the church</li>
<li>Asserting and agreeing on some mission action and implementing it</li>
<li>Acting on the Great Commandment to love God and neighbor and the Great Commission to make disciples of all nations, using holy mission experiments</li>
<li>Assessing and learning from setbacks and successes</li>
</ul>
<p>The illustration (<em>below)</em>, attempts to describe the cyclical, ebb and flow nature of this congregational renewal journey being facilitated by our Synods’ Renewal Team.</p>

<h4><strong>Preparing for the Journey:</strong></h4>
<ul>
<li>Prayer and discussion with congregational leaders involving an overview of the process and suggestions for how prayer and conversation might actually happen in the congregation</li>
<li>Congregation commits to taking journey and allocates $300 to cover costs (e.g. materials, meals, etc.)</li>
<li>Congregation and pastor assemble a team (at least four, including pas- tor) to accompany their congregation and shepherd the process</li>
<li>Congregation’s team enters into a time of prayer and reflection on the Book of Acts in preparation for the first equipping event on February 25, 2012</li>
</ul>
<h4><strong>Teams attending can expect to: </strong></h4>
<ul>
<li>Be immersed in prayer and God’s word</li>
<li>Receive tools, best practices, resources, and be equipped to utilize and adapt them to their congregation’s context</li>
<li>Be accompanied by a coach throughout the whole journey</li>
<li>Receive additional training as needed, tailored to specific issues along the way</li>
</ul>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>In the winter of 2011 the Health Ministry Team of <a href="http://www.messiahfargo.com/" class="external">Messiah Lutheran (Fargo)</a> organized volunteers (ages 9 to 94) and began making &#8220;Pillowcase Dresses and Britches&#8221; for the Little Dresses for Africa project. This is a non-denominational organization based in Michigan that provides clothing to children in need.<em> <a href="http://littledressesforafrica.org" class="external">Learn more at littledressesforafrica.org</a></em></p>
<p>Messiah’s initial project produced <strong>239 dresses</strong> and <strong>51 britches (</strong>shorts) for boys. It began with gathering supplies, spending time together (or at home during the winter months), and producing the garments in love. The youth at Messiah tie-dyed donated white pillowcases. This became <strong>a multi-generational project for the church</strong>. <span id="more-3130"></span></p>
<p><img class="size-medium wp-image-3132 alignleft" title="pillowcase dresses2" src="http://www.eandsynod.org/news/wp-content/uploads/2011/11/pillowcase-dresses2-222x300.jpg" alt="" width="178" height="240" />God used the <strong>hands of volunteers</strong> at Messiah, and the congregation was graced with beautiful clothing hanging on clotheslines in the sanctuary. The Hour of Worship televised service from Messiah Lutheran allowed us the opportunity to share this project with the viewers. We received donations of binding, elastic, ribbons, pillowcases, and money from people in Minnesota, North Dakota, South Dakota, Pennsylvania and Canada. More importantly God worked through the Hour of Worship to <strong>share the excitement of this project</strong>, with 59 other churches contacting Messiah’s Parish Nurse, Sandi Kimmet, RN, forinformation on how to implement the project at their churches. God&#8217;s Hands led the hands of this congregation to reach out in an even greater way.</p>
<p>Sandi has maintained contact with Rachel O&#8217;Neill, the director of Little Dresses for Africa. She learned that some of the dresses from Messiah were sent to Haiti with medical volunteers following the earthquake and some were sent to Malawi for orphans who were left without clothing. These clothing items are light weight, easy to roll and pack up. This is a benefit for international travelers. God’s work. Our hands.</p>
